What to expect

Why choose between a volcano walk and stargazing when you can have both? This 3-hour journey immerses you in Fuerteventura’s raw beauty before exploring the night sky.

We begin with a moderate one hour trek through ancient volcanic terrain. We provide walking sticks for every guest for a comfortable journey. Timed for the "Golden Hour" and "Blue Hour," the trek offers the best light to see rugged, lunar-like landscapes. Whether using a camera or a smartphone, the natural volcanic views are incredible.

At nightfall, we transition to a relaxed stargazing session. Using professional telescopes and individual binoculars for every participant, we’ll use high power lasers to "draw" on the sky, identifying constellations and planets. From late May to October, we look for the spectacular Milky Way, while other months focus on brilliant seasonal stars.

The Best of Both Worlds. An active 1 hour hike followed by a relaxed, educational session under the stars.

Cloud Cover Strategy: If the sky isn't perfectly clear, the adventure continues. We enjoy the unique atmosphere; clouds often provide dramatic "windows" that reveal the stars in artistic ways.
